Velký Osek – Sány (výhybna Kanín)

[020] (ERA-E 92C5; ERA-R 191A2; 23) CZ23/2

There are two single-track routes between Velký Osek and the line eastwards towards Chlumec nad Cidlinou: one (1.6 km long) direct to the north-east, and the other a 4.2 km loop line initially heading south-east and then curving round due north. The hourly Praha - Nymburk - Chlumec - Hradec Králové and v.v. expresses use the loop line to avoid reversal at Velký Osek station. The 2-hourly through trains between Kolín and Chlumec use the direct curve. Click on the thumbnail for a full size map.

Nymburk město – Nymburk hl.n.

[020, 060] (ERA-E 92C5; ERA-R 191A2; 22) CZ23/3A

As well as being used by the hourly local service between Pořičany and Nymburk hl.n., this south to east curve is used by R trains between Praha hl.n. and Hradec Králové or Trutnov. These run mainly hourly. Any train between Praha and Hradec Králové calling at Praha-Libeň will have to take this route.

All trains in this entry and the previous one except the local trains to and from Pořičany also use the connection from the main line to the branch at Pořičany.

(Pardubice -) Břevnice (odbočka Kubešův Mlýn) – Havlíčkův Brod (HB St. Tunel)

[238] (ERA-E 91A1,not shown, ERA-R 196B5; 56) CZ23/8

The rare route to/from table 238 is a 400m connection between the Pardubice - Havlíčkův Brod line and the Havlíčkův Brod - Brno line and informed sources suggest none are scheduled in 2022/23.

Click on the thumbnail for a full size map.


Havlíčkův Brod is a V-shaped station: platforms 1 - 4 serve the main (Praha -) Kolin - Brno line and platform 5, at an angle, is the shorter and usual route to/from odb. Kubešův Mlýn (- Pardubice). It is not possible to tell from the timetable which route trains to/from the Pardubice line will use, but the usual is to/from platform 5 and the northern route, as opposed to via the Brno line and HB St. Tunel and note drivers normally change ends after arrival at Havlíčkův Brod platform 5 so do not run via the Brno line as a "balloon loop".

Only table 238 services booked to use platforms 1 - 4 are certain to run via HB St. Tunel so the compilers would greatly appreciate information of any such services using 1 - 4 as they are not shown on the Platform departure sheets.

This route was used between March and December 2021 by all trains on this line when the normal route via the northern curve was unavailable due to engineering works.

(Brno hl.n. - ) Křenovice horní n. – Holubice

[260, 300] (ERA-E 95B2; ERA-R 197B3-B4; 75) CZ23/9

Most trains on the Brno - Přerov line use the connection between Blažovice (on the Brno - Veselí nad Moravou line) and Holubice. Some services run via the more southerly, single track route via Sokolnice-Telnice, on which there is a regular service between Brno hl.n. and Křenovice horní nádraží. Trains can be identified in Table 300 by a vertical wavy line against Blažovice. Route changes are sometimes made for pathing reasons to accommodate late running.

Note that both routes are shown in ERA-R as Line/Table 300 but stopping services on the Sokolnice route are in Table 260.

Česká Třebová yard staff train

[260, 270] (ERA-E 94C2 not shown; ERA-R 192A1; 83A) CZ23/11

An unadvertised service has been observed in recent years leaving at approximately 14:00 from a short concrete platform, one track further over from the last public platform at Česká Třebová station. It turns off the main line about 200 m south of the station and follows what are shown as lines 91 or 93 in the Malkus Atlas Drah - west of the locomotive depot, where there is a stop. It continues past the roundhouse and turntable and terminates at a platform opposite what is probably the hump control tower. This is clearly an “end of shift” service as it is lightly loaded leaving Česká Třebová but very busy on the return working. The service is not intended for public use, so access may be refused. The compilers would appreciate information on this or any other such services that may run at other shift change times.

This route has also been used in recent years by special shuttle services that run to the yards when there is an open day at the depot. An Open Day was held on 03 September 2022 when these shuttle services were scheduled to run.

Bohumín Přednádraží Goods lines

[270] (ERA-E 95A5 not shown; ERA-R 193B2 not shown; 46 as line 305A) CZ23/15

This is a 1.4km alternative route between Ostrava Vrbice and Bohumin via Bohumín Přednádraží. This line can only be used by trains arriving or departing from Bohumin platforms/track 3/3, 4/5 and 4/9, but note it is also possible to access these platforms to/from the main line. A train number search on a Czech "Real Times Trains" will find some services allowed additional running time [at least 3m 30s] between Bohumín-Vrbice and Bohumin so possibly could use this line if scheduled to/from the above platforms, [arrivals thought to be more likely], but this is far from guaranteed, for example a 12:43 departure from platform 4/5 on 31 May 2023 crossed to the main line.

Additionally EC130 has been observed twice taking this route, with the sightings several months apart but as it is not booked to take over 3m 30s it is suspected, this and any other use is subject to train punctuality so the compilers would welcome further observations

Strančice – Velke Popovice

(ERA-E 92C4; ERA-R 189C4; 36) CZ23/17

This 5.1km branch runs to the Kozel brewery at Velké Popovice. A train runs on odd Festival dates plus Saturdays from June to September between Praha hl.n. and the brewery. The branch is very steeply graded and serves some factories but there is no rail traffic to the brewery. The train stops at a platform just before the site gate from where a brisk 10 minute walk down an earth path and road leads to the Brewery main entrance.

See the Kozel website and the outbound normally leaves Hl.n. just after 10am. Advance booking is recommended but any remaining places can allegedly be purchased at Hl.n. on the train. Děčín-Prostřední Žleb - Děčín východ dolní nádraží – Děčín přístav Loubí

(ERA-E 92A4; ERA-R 190B4 (Quay Branch not shown on either); 8A) CZ23/18

This freight line and 3.3km freight branch has a passenger service, operated by KŽC Doprava, s.r.o., annually in connection with the Czech Republic International Championship of Pump Trolley Racing. This event is held on the Czech-Saxon Harbour Company (Česko-saské přístavy, s.r.o.) River Labe quay sidings at Děčín-Loubí and in 2021 was on 28 August. The competition is usually limited to 10 teams competing over a 1.67km length siding traversed three times. The 2022 event was cancelled and it remains to be seen if there will be a Championship again in 2023.

Čáslav – voj. letiště Chotusice

(ERA-E 92C5; ERA-R 191B1; 38) CZ23/19

A 4.7km long branch runs northwards from the Třemošnice branch platform at Čáslav to serve Chotusice air base, home of the 21. základna taktického letectva (21st Tactical Air Force Base). There is a shuttle service when there is an air show at the base to a covered platform on the base perimeter adjacent to a 3km post, 3.3km from the Třemošnice branch platforms.

A service ran on 20 May 2017, with departures from Čáslav at 09:15, 10:15, 11:15, 12:15, 13:15, 14:00, 15:00, 16:00 and 17:00. This event normally takes place every two years and the last event was on 25 May 2019. The 2021 event was cancelled due to Covid, but an air show is planned for 20 May 2023. Bílovice nad Svitavou (odb. Hady) – Brno Maloměřice Yard – Brno-Židenice

[260] (ERA-E 95B2 not shown; ERA-R 198C2 not shown; 79A) CZ23/38

Access to/egress from the north end of Maloměřice Yard from/to the Praha - Česká Třebová - Skalice nad Svitavou - Brno line is provided by two connections from odb. Hady, one on the north side of the main line and one on the south side. Several routes are possible through Maloměřice Yard. This route was used in the 2017-2018 Timetable period by Os4051 Blansko - 15:57 Bílovice nad Svitavou - Brno-Židenice which was allowed 8 min from Bílovice nad Svitavou to Brno-Židenice, as opposed to the 5 or 6 min allowed for all other trains, and was the only train to terminate at Brno-Židenice, so it seems probable that this was the booked route. However, there are no similar trains in the 2022-2023 timetable. A connection from the Havlíčkův Brod - Tišnov - Brno line into Maloměřice Yard is available at odb. Brno-Obřany. Both routes have been used in the past (e.g. June - August 2015) when there has been an engineering blockade.

Brno dolní nádraží – Brno-Horni Herspice obd. St. silnice

[240/244] (ERA-E 95B2 not shown; ERA-R 198C2; 79A) CZ23/39

Normally a freight-only route crossing the Brno - Břeclav main line on a flyover. This has been in regular passenger use since 9 January 2023 following damage to the viaduct over the Svratka River south of Brno hl.n. in December 2022 which has led to one of the four tracks in that area being taken out of use. A temporary timetable was initially introduced with most weekday S4 services to/from the Střelice direction starting from / terminating at Brno dolní nádraží, with a free connecting shuttle bus "X" to / from Brno hl.n. These changes have now been incorporated into the permanent timetable effective from 12 March 2023 and should continue until December 2023 when repair work is expected to be complete.
